The canal was first built in 1866 when the King ordered a 32 kilometre canal be built to connect Mae Klong River with the Tacheen River. You can take a ride through the canal on one of the narrow wooden long boats, rubbing bows with those piled high with fruit and vegetables grown locally in the excellent soils near the canal. You can see the whole panorama from the sides of the canal, but the boat ride gives you a very close up experience.The locals use this waterway as a main transport route

There are rows of craft stalls selling anything and everything. If the snacks and light meals are not sufficient there are is a choice of sit down restaurants. A visit to these Floating Markets is a wonderful way to experience traditional Thai life and culture.
